titleOfInvention Device and process for coupling to produce hydrogen by photoelectrically and catalytically degrading organic pollutant through utilizing solar drive
abstract The invention discloses a device and a process for coupling to produce hydrogen by photoelectrically and catalytically degrading an organic pollutant through utilizing solar drive. The device comprises a reactor, a hydrogen collecting device and a light source, and further comprising a solar battery, wherein the reactor is internally provided with at least one reaction tank; the reaction tank is internally provided with at least one pair of photoelectrical electrode pair; a cathode and an anode of the photoelectrical electrode pair are connected with the solar battery; a magnetic agitator is arranged at the bottom of the reaction tank; and the reaction tank is internally provided with a magneton. According to the device and the process disclosed by the invention, the structure is simple, a photoelectrical battery system is effectively utilized, solar light is sufficiently utilized, a power supply does not need to be additionally arranged, and the energy consumption is reduced.
